Breaking Barriers is a specialist refugee employment charity. Enabling refugees to build new lives. Step by step. The charity believes in the power of responsible businesses and welcomes refugees into meaningful employment with one-to-one advice and guidance, education, and training. Helping people find financial independence, purpose, and identity through work. Job Responsibilities:
